New starters at Merrowfield Associates should note that Room 1C, the secure interview suite, operates under stricter rules than the rest of the building. All visitors attending interviews must be met in reception, escorted directly to the suite, and never left unaccompanied, even briefly. Recording devices, personal phones, and bags are stored in the lockers outside the door. After each session, confirm the room is empty and the log is signed. To open the suite door, enter the code below.

staff pass of kawip-hawef = bdg-QLP-2

Welcome aboard. As part of the team reshuffle, responsibility for the Tidecrest autoscaler is changing hands this week. The autoscaler watches queue depth on the ingest workers and scales replicas between the configured floor and ceiling; thresholds live in the service config, and every change requires a canary window before full apply. Please review the runbook before making adjustments, and treat the cooldown settings as load-bearing. Going forward, all scaling-policy decisions rest with the engineer named below.

signatory, tadup-fahog: Zorwyn Keleth

Handover — Vexler partner SFTP drop

Ownership moves to you today. Drop runs hourly from Vexler's end into the intake bucket via the relay host. Watch for zero-byte files; their exporter flakes on Mondays. Creds live in the ops vault, path noted in the runbook. Vault auto-seals after 48h idle. Support escalations go to the on-call rotation, not me. If the vault is sealed when you need it, unseal with the recovery passphrase below.

recovery phrase for tadug-fafof: zorwyn-kasion